Disclaimer: The Florida Department of Business & Professional Regulation describes an inspection report as “a ‘snapshot’ of conditions present at the time of the inspection." On any given day, an establishment may have fewer or more violations than noted in their most recent inspection. An inspection conducted on any given day may not be representative of the overall, long-term conditions at the establishment.

Dunkin'

300 Washington Blvd. N., Sarasota

Aug. 16

Emergency order recommended. Facility temporarily closed.

14 total violations, with 4 high-priority violations:

  • High Priority - Employee touched soiled surface and then engaged in food preparation, handled clean equipment or utensils, or touched unwrapped single-service items without washing hands. Observed employee use their phone and then touch clean equipment without washing their hands. Observed employee moving a trash can and then touch clean utensils without washing hands. Instructed the employees that they needed to wash their hands. Employees washed hands and changed gloves. **Corrected On-Site** **Warning**

  • High Priority - Rodent activity present as evidenced by rodent droppings found. Observed approximately 10 rodent droppings next to and under the hand washing sink in the front counter area. Observed approximately 40 rodent droppings under the preparation tables in the serving/front counter area. Observed approximately 30 rodent droppings under the single service storage racks in the dry storage area. Observed approximately 20 rodent droppings under the chemical storage rack in the dry storage area. **Warning**

  • High Priority - Toxic substance/chemical improperly stored. Observed a spray bottle containing cleaning fluid stored next to the syrup pumps on the front counter. Employee removed spray bottle. As a repeat violation the importance of following proper protocol with this violation was reinforced with the employee. **Corrected On-Site** **Repeat Violation** **Warning**

  • High Priority - Vacuum breaker missing at mop sink faucet or on fitting/splitter added to mop sink faucet. Observed no vacuum breaker attached to the splitter at the mop sink. **Warning**
